Historical Context and Evolution

Davidson’s Principles and Practice of Medicine was initially authored by Sir Stanley

Davidson, a Scottish physician whose vision was to create an accessible yet detailed guide

that bridged basic medical science with clinical application. Over the decades, the

textbook has undergone numerous revisions and updates, reflecting advances in medical

knowledge, diagnostic techniques, and therapeutic strategies. The continued stewardship

by a panel of expert editors ensures that the content remains current and inclusive of

emerging trends in medicine.

Unlike many medical textbooks that focus predominantly on rote memorization,

Davidson’s emphasizes the pathophysiological basis of diseases, which aids in deeper

conceptual understanding. Its longevity and global reach testify to its adaptability and

ongoing relevance.

System-Based Approach

The textbook adopts a system-based approach, dividing content into chapters such as

cardiovascular, respiratory, gastrointestinal, neurological, and endocrine disorders. Each

chapter begins with a succinct overview of relevant anatomy and physiology, followed by

discussions on epidemiology, etiology, clinical manifestations, diagnostic modalities, and

treatment options.

Comparative Analysis: Davidson’s vs Other Medical Textbooks

In the competitive landscape of medical literature, Davidson Principles and Practice of

Medicine holds its own alongside other renowned texts such as Harrison’s Principles of

Internal Medicine and Kumar & Clark’s Clinical Medicine.

Depth vs Breadth: While Harrison’s often delves deeper into pathophysiological

1.

nuances, Davidson’s is praised for its balanced coverage that is neither too

superficial nor excessively detailed, making it ideal for undergraduate and early

postgraduate learners.

Clinical Orientation: Kumar & Clark focuses heavily on clinical examination and

2.

patient management, whereas Davidson’s integrates basic science more

thoroughly, providing a stronger foundation in disease mechanisms.

Global Relevance: Davidson’s has a distinctive emphasis on conditions prevalent

3.

in both developed and developing countries, broadening its applicability

internationally.
